1) My MQSeries 5.2 is running on Windows2000 machine. When i make a
 
local(Server) connection to the Queue manger, i am getting the MQ
 
rror( both 'amqsget' and 'amqsput' fails with the Error Code "MQCONN ended with reason code 2059"  though  my Queue Manager and Listener is running well. But if i make a client connection by setting up client environments in the same machine and try connecting to the Queue manager it works fine(Can access all the MQ Objects). Why i couldn't make a local connection to the Queue Manager?. Please let me know.
 
 
Also, When I log into the machine via terminal services, and use the
 
MQSeries explorer, I can see my queue manager, but no queues under it.  If I use the "connect" option, the explorer returns an error message that "Queue Manager not available for connection... (AMQ4043)". But if i make a remote connection option(Show Remote Queue Manager) using MQSeries explorer, the Queue Manager and their objects are shown well. Why this problem occurs?. 				Answer 
 
1) Did you configure the queue manager as default ??? 
 
    Try  amqsput  QUEUE_NAME QMGR_NAME (if this works you havent
 
       set the qmgr as default.
 
 
2) I have read post's here that there are issues with terminal services and 
 
   not to use them, you might want to search/read them _________________ Jeff

				The listener doesnt have to be running for a  MQServer Application just
 
the clients or server-server communications.
 
 
did you try the amqsput/amqsget with  QUEUE_NAME QMGR_NAME ??? _________________ Jeff

I found out that this problem occur because of Terminal Service 5.0 which we are using currently. But i heard from someone that Terminal Service 5.3 supports the shared memory feature in a convenient way. Do u have any idea about that?.
